Why “Modern Literature” and Why Now?
The term “Modern Literature” typically refers to the literary works produced roughly between the late 19th century and the mid-20th century. This period was a time of immense upheaval and change, reflecting the rapid industrialization, urbanization, and societal shifts happening across the globe. Think of it as a period when authors grappled with the challenges and uncertainties of a rapidly evolving world, exploring themes of alienation, identity, and the search for meaning in a fragmented society.
